The Gulf crimson snapper population still contains much too several older (higher than 20 years) folks. Crimson snapper can live quite a while (Pretty much sixty years), and also the more mature purple snapper women generate much more, bigger excellent eggs. Limitations on harvest of red snapper are designed not simply to improve red snapper abundance but will also to permit crimson snapper to succeed in older, possibly extra successful ages And so the populace can completely rebuild.

Red snapper have been severely overfished within the Gulf but at the moment are on their way again. The Gulf snapper population attained its lower level the late nineteen eighties, but because then science based mostly and effective management and favorable conditions for reproduction have place the crimson snapper within the road to recovery. Considering that 2009 capture boundaries for snapper have steadily increased.
